Sid & Ann Mashburn to Debut Holiday Pop-up Shop at Avalon

10/19/20

Opening Nov. 6, luxury lifestyle brand introduces new concept for the holidays

This holiday season, renowned Atlanta-based design duo Sid & Ann Mashburn will debut the lifestyle brand’s first-ever Atlanta pop-up concept at Avalon, the premier mixed-use community and destination in Alpharetta developed and managed by North American Properties (NAP). Opening on Nov. 6th, just in time for holiday shopping along the Boulevard, the Sid & Ann Mashburn Pop-Up Shop joins Avalon’s best-in-class lineup of national retail brands, including Apple, Peloton and lululemon.

Sid and Ann are known throughout the retail industry, with VOGUE calling Ann Mashburn “the very best of everything in one place” and both GQ and Esquire naming Sid Mashburn “the best men’s store in America.” The holiday shop will pop-up in a 4,000-square-foot space near Sephora and Cafe Intermezzo. The shop will feature the best of Sid and Ann’s designed-and-produced clothing, offering a merchandise mix that includes their favorite classic, iconic and hard-to-find pieces. Sid and Ann will spend time in the shop each week, offering their design and style insight to Avalon’s shoppers.

“This is the first time we’ve ever opened a space in Atlanta outside of our West Midtown Flagship, so this is a big deal for us. We’ve been longtime admirers of Avalon and the special sense of community that’s been built there, and we are excited to be part of that energy this holiday season.” – Sid & Ann.

In addition to their fashion acumen, the Mashburns are well known for their ability to flawlessly combine their men’s and women’s stores in spaces as welcoming as they are inspiring, with their signature mix of modern and classic. These elements will be reflected in the pop-up through vintage Turkish rugs, mood boards, a ping-pong table, vinyl records playing, and cold drinks for customers offered by friendly staff. The shop will be open to the public through the end of the year.

The duo first made their mark in Atlanta in 2007 with the opening of Sid Mashburn in the Westside Provisions District in West Midtown. In 2010, they introduced Ann Mashburn, the brand’s womenswear line. Today, the Atlanta Flagship is one of four connected men’s and women’s shops across the country, including Dallas, Houston & Georgetown, along with a standalone men’s shop in Los Angeles.

About North American Properties

Founded in 1954, North American Properties is a privately held, multi-regional real estate operating and development company that has acquired, developed and managed more than $7 billion of mixed-use, retail, multifamily and office properties across the United States. Rooted in its purpose-driven approach to development, North American Properties is creating great places that connect people to each other; cities to their souls; partners to opportunities; and individuals to experiences that move them. Headquartered in Cincinnati, with offices in Atlanta, Dallas and Fort Myers, Florida, the company has developed 22 million square feet of commercial space and 19,000 residential units in 15 states and 67 cities. In the past three years, North American Properties has launched 36 projects totaling $2.2 billion in total capitalization. In metro Atlanta, North American Properties led the turnaround of Atlantic Station and the ground up development of Avalon. Currently, the company’s mixed-use pipeline includes: Colony Square in Midtown Atlanta, Newport on the Levee in Newport, Kentucky and Riverton in the New York metro area.
